Ivan Savenko a0b69d79f0 NKAI2 performance improvements 6 天之前
..
ArmyManager.cpp a4a9927e9e more cc renaming; BuildingID get level index and upgrades; Creatures renaming 4 月之前
ArmyManager.h a4a9927e9e more cc renaming; BuildingID get level index and upgrades; Creatures renaming 4 月之前
BuildAnalyzer.cpp a0b69d79f0 NKAI2 performance improvements 6 天之前
BuildAnalyzer.h 6df299d892 ResourceTrader improvements and testing finished 3 月之前
DangerHitMapAnalyzer.cpp 8ecf1f52e9 Reduce AI logging to avoid performance hit 2 周之前
DangerHitMapAnalyzer.h 7a40981a95 overall refactoring, HeroPtr adjustments, AiNodeStorage remove unnecessary callback 3 月之前
HeroManager.cpp b8eb49bc82 finished removing thread local from NK2 3 月之前
HeroManager.h 7a40981a95 overall refactoring, HeroPtr adjustments, AiNodeStorage remove unnecessary callback 3 月之前
ObjectClusterizer.cpp a836cd3aed fix: time-of-check-to-time-of-use (TOCTOU) race condition in AIMemory::removeInvisibleObjects; a bit of refactoring in RecruitHeroBehavior and some todo comments for later on 3 月之前
ObjectClusterizer.h 58543f23cf refactoring RecruitHeroBehavior + test sample; renamed more Nullkiller variables consistently 4 月之前